-BLT ISH-
What you will need for 4 'wraps'*:
4 large Romaine leaves rinsed and dried
2-3 slices thick bacon cooked and chopped into small pieces
12-15 mini heirloom tomatoes quartered
1 small avocado cut into small chunks
salt and pepper to taste
yellow mustard or vegenaise optional
Place tomatoes and avocado inside the romaine leaves, top with chopped bacon bits, sea salt and black pepper.... literally I feel like this is such a cop out recipe... but you guys, it is delicious so whatever.
